
无论是金融、医疗、教育还是电子商务等领域,数据的完整性、可用性和安全性都是企业持续运营和发展的基石
然而,数据库作为数据存储和管理的核心组件,时刻面临着各种故障的风险,如硬件故障、软件错误、人为失误、自然灾害乃至网络攻击等
一旦数据库发生故障,可能导致数据丢失、业务中断,甚至引发法律风险和声誉损失
因此,实施有效的数据库故障备份与恢复策略,构建稳固的数据保护机制,对于企业而言至关重要
一、数据库故障的类型与影响 数据库故障大致可以分为以下几类: 1.硬件故障:硬盘损坏、服务器宕机等物理设备问题
2.软件故障:操作系统崩溃、数据库管理系统(DBMS)错误、应用程序漏洞等
3.人为错误:误删除数据、配置错误、不当操作等
4.自然灾害:火灾、洪水、地震等不可抗力导致的物理损害
5.网络攻击:黑客入侵、勒索软件、恶意病毒等
这些故障不仅会导致数据丢失或损坏,还可能引发业务连续性中断,影响客户信任度,造成巨大的经济损失
例如,2017年全球范围内爆发的WannaCry勒索软件攻击,众多企业和政府机构的数据库遭受侵袭,大量重要数据被加密锁定,严重影响了日常运营
二、备份策略:未雨绸缪,防患于未然 为了有效应对数据库故障,首要任务是制定并实施周密的备份策略
一个完善的备份方案应涵盖以下几个方面: 1.全量备份与增量/差异备份: -全量备份:定期对整个数据库进行完整复制,适用于数据变化不大或需要全面保护的情况
-增量备份:仅备份自上次备份以来发生变化的数据部分,减少备份时间和存储空间需求
-差异备份:备份自上次全量备份以来所有发生变化的数据,介于全量和增量之间,平衡了恢复速度和备份量
2.备份频率与保留周期:根据数据的重要性和变化频率,设定合理的备份周期和保留策略
关键业务数据可能需要更频繁的备份和更长的保留期
3.异地备份:将备份数据存储在远离主数据中心的地方,以防止本地灾难性事件导致数据丢失
这包括使用云存储服务或建立远程备份站点
4.自动化备份:利用数据库管理系统的自动化备份功能或第三方工具,减少人为错误,确保备份任务的定期执行
5.备份验证:定期对备份数据进行恢复测试,确保备份的有效性和可用性,避免“备份即失效”的情况
三、恢复策略:快速响应,恢复如初 备份是前提,恢复才是目的
当数据库发生故障时,迅速而准确的恢复策略能够最大限度地减少业务中断时间
有效的恢复策略包括: 1.灾难恢复计划:事先制定详细的灾难恢复计划,明确故障发现、报告、评估、恢复和验证的流程,以及各环节的负责人和责任分工
2.快速切换与故障转移:利用数据库的高可用性(HA)和灾难恢复(DR)技术,如主从复制、集群、多活数据中心等,实现故障发生时的快速切换和数据同步,确保业务连续性
3.时间点恢复:利用备份和日志信息,将数据库恢复到故障发生前的特定时间点,尽可能减少数据丢失
这对于金融交易、医疗记录等对数据一致性要求极高的场景尤为重要
4.最小化恢复时间目标(RTO)和恢复点目标(RPO):根据业务需求设定RTO和RPO,即在可接受的时间内恢复业务运行和可容忍的数据丢失量,以此指导备份和恢复策略的设计
5.培训与演练:定期对IT团队进行灾难恢复培训和模拟演练,提升团队应对突发事件的能力和效率
四、技术趋势与创新 随着技术的不断进步,数据库备份与恢复领域也在不断革新,以适应大数据、云计算、人工智能等新兴技术的挑战
例如: - 云备份与恢复:利用云服务的弹性、可扩展性和高可用性,实现更加灵活、成本效益更高的备份解决方案
- 容器化与微服务架构:在容器化环境中,通过微服务架构,可以更容易地实现数据库的分布式部署和故障隔离,提高恢复效率
- AI辅助的数据恢复:利用机器学习算法分析数据模式,预测潜在的数据损坏风险,甚至在部分数据丢失的情况下,通过数据重建技术恢复丢失信息
- 区块链技术:虽然区块链主要用于分布式账本和加密货币,但其不可篡改的特性为数据备份提供了新的思路,特别是在需要高度信任的数据存储场景中
五、结语 数据库故障备份与恢复是确保企业数据安全、维护业务连续性的基石
面对日益复杂多变的威胁环境,企业必须从战略高度出发,构建全面、高效、灵活的备份与恢复体系
这要求企业不仅要采用先进的技术手段,还要建立健全的管理制度,加强人员培训,形成文化与技术的双重保障
只有这样,才能在数据洪流中稳住舵盘,确保企业航船稳健前行
在数字化转型的浪潮中,让我们携手并进,共同守护数据的安全与未来
数据库故障:备份恢复全攻略
解读SQL数据库备份文件的方法
全面解析:如何实现高效服务器冗余备份策略
中小企业必备:高效服务器备份系统指南
群晖NAS:主从数据库备份同步指南
C盘爆满!服务器备份空间告急
高效自动同步,打造无忧备份服务器
解读SQL数据库备份文件的方法
全面解析:如何实现高效服务器冗余备份策略
中小企业必备:高效服务器备份系统指南
群晖NAS:主从数据库备份同步指南
C盘爆满!服务器备份空间告急
高效自动同步,打造无忧备份服务器
RAC数据库备份全攻略
企业管理器备份文件操作指南
SQL备份中重建数据库的秘籍
腾讯云服务器:支持本地备份吗?
数据库表备份指南:轻松保护数据
Windows服务器文件备份实战指南